Principles of method if other than guideline:
ASA was added to culured human lymphocytes at several time periods over a wide range of concentrations in vitro (0.1 to 300 microg/ml) or after human volunters ingestion of 2 tablest (300 mg) 4 times a day for 1 month ( Plasma concentration was measured at each time of harvest.
In vitro addition at To ,T48 or T68 with 4 donors; harvest at 72 hours.

Applicant's summary and conclusion

Conclusions:
ASA was not inducing chromosomal aberrations in human lymphocytes either by incubation in vitro or after a month administration (2400 mg/day).
Executive summary:

A study was done with human lymphocytes of 4 donors, incubated in vitro for 72 hours, or after 1 month oral ASA administration (2400 mg/day). No combination of the study indicated an effect of ASA on chromosomal aberrations
